Barn roof replacement services involve removing an existing roof structure and installing a new roofing system on a property’s barn or similar outbuilding. This process typically includes assessing the current roof’s condition, removing damaged or outdated materials, and carefully installing new roofing components such as sheathing, underlayment, and the final roofing surface. The goal is to ensure the structure remains protected from weather elements while enhancing its durability and appearance. Professionals specializing in barn roof replacement can work with a variety of roofing materials, including metal, asphalt shingles, or wood shakes, depending on the specific needs and preferences of the property owner.
This service addresses common issues that can compromise a barn’s integrity, such as leaks, extensive weather damage, rotting wood, or aging materials that no longer provide adequate protection. A compromised roof can lead to interior damage, mold growth, and even structural weakening if not addressed promptly. Barn roof replacement helps prevent these problems by restoring the roof’s ability to shield the building from water infiltration and other environmental factors. Material and Size Costs - The cost of barn roof replacement varies based on the size and type of materials used. Typically, prices range from $3,000 to $10,000 for standard-sized barns with asphalt shingles or metal roofing. Larger structures or premium materials can increase expenses significantly.
Labor and Installation Fees - Labor costs for barn roof replacement generally account for 50% to 70% of the total project cost. Expect to pay between $1,500 and $5,000 for professional installation, depending on the complexity of the job and local labor rates.
Additional Expenses - Extra costs may include roof decking repairs, removal of old roofing, or permits, which can add $500 to $2,000 to the overall price. These expenses vary based on the barn’s condition and local regulations.
Cost Factors and Variations - Factors such as roof pitch, accessibility, and material choices influence the final cost. Prices for barn roof replacement services typically range from $4,000 to $15,000 in Mount Prospect, IL, and nearby areas.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How often should a barn roof be replaced? The lifespan of a barn roof varies based on materials and maintenance, but generally, it may need replacement every 20 to 30 years. A local professional can assess the roof’s condition to determine if replacement is necessary.
What signs indicate a barn roof needs replacement? Visible damage such as missing or broken shingles, leaks, sagging areas, or significant wear can signal the need for roof replacement. A consultation with a local contractor can confirm the condition.
What types of roofing materials are suitable for barns? Common options include metal, asphalt shingles, wood shakes, and rubber roofing. Local service providers can advise on the best materials based on durability and budget.
How long does a barn roof replacement typically take? The duration depends on the size and complexity of the roof, but many replacements can be completed within a few days by experienced contractors in the area.
